"Shadow Games: The Fourth Chronicles of the Black Company: First Book of the South" by Glen Cook follows the mercenary group known as the Black Company as they navigate the complexities of war and power in a dark fantasy setting. The narrative shifts between the harsh realities of battle and the mystical elements that define their world, showcasing the nuanced nature of good and evil. Cook's writing immerses the reader in a gritty atmosphere, highlighting the moral ambiguities faced by the characters.
The story is told through the eyes of Croaker, the company's doctor and chronicler. He grapples with the shifting allegiances and treacherous political intrigues of the factions they encounter. As the Black Company becomes embroiled in conflicts that test their loyalty and resolve, they must confront both external enemies and internal challenges that threaten their unity.
